Presidency’s Renewed Hope Initiative (RHI), spearheaded by Nigeria’s First Lady, Senator Oluremi Tinubu, has reached a new milestone in the South-West region, as thousands of women in Ondo State received vital empowerment and health support during a grand event held in Akure.

The Governor of Ondo State, Dr. Lucky Orimisan Aiyedatiwa, while welcoming the First Lady to the regional launch of the initiative at the International Culture and Events Centre (The Dome), described Mrs. Tinubu as a “national treasure and mother of the nation” for her continued efforts in improving the lives of women and healthcare workers.

According to him, “This thoughtful gesture will undoubtedly have a profound impact on maternal and child health in our region. It will boost the morale of our nurses and midwives and enhance the quality of care they provide.”

The highlight of the event was the distribution of 10,000 professional kits—comprising scrubs and Crocs—to nurses and midwives across the South-West. Governor Aiyedatiwa called it a “strategic intervention” that aligns closely with Ondo State’s healthcare development objectives and emphasized the broader economic and social impact of investing in maternal and child health.

The First Lady explained that the Renewed Hope Initiative was created to complement Federal Government efforts and directly uplift communities across the country. “This initiative is not just about giving; it is about building. It is about showing our appreciation for those who serve and supporting the most vulnerable among us,” Mrs. Tinubu stated.

She also announced a N50 million empowerment grant to be handed over to the wife of the Governor, Mrs. Oluwaseun Aiyedatiwa, for onward distribution to rural women across Ondo State. Additionally, 200 women in the textile industry are to be empowered under the RHI.

Mrs. Tinubu praised the Ondo State Governor for his administration’s inclusive policies and for ensuring female representation in governance. “Governor Aiyedatiwa has shown true commitment to the welfare of women in Ondo, and I commend him for that,” she said.

The event also saw the First Lady introduce future programmes, including “Flow with Confidence,” aimed at distributing 10,000 sanitary pads per state to girls in rural areas. She also reiterated her appeal to traditional rulers to support initiatives targeting the well-being of women and children.

In a separate meeting with the Ondo State Council of Obas, held ahead of the launch, Mrs. Tinubu received pledges of support and prayers. Speaking on behalf of the council, the Deji of Akure, Oba Aladetoyinbo Aladelusi, who represented the Chairman, Oba Gbadegesin Ogunoye, said, “We appreciate the First Lady’s tireless support for President Tinubu and her dedication to improving lives. Your presence here is a blessing to our people.”

The First Lady also revealed more components of the RHI, including the launch of the Free to Shine campaign to eliminate mother-to-child transmission of HIV/AIDS, syphilis, and hepatitis. She noted that education and agriculture remain core areas of intervention, with each state’s First Lady receiving N68.9 million to support women farmers under the Young Farmers’ Club and women’s gardening initiative—supported by a N400 billion federal agricultural fund.

Mrs. Tinubu further stated that the initiative also includes scholarship schemes and international study opportunities, including education for teenage mothers through Alternative High Schools for Girls. “The school provides education, life skills, and childcare support through on-site crèches. It’s already running in Osun and will soon be launched here in Ondo,” she said.

In her welcome address, the wife of the Governor, Mrs. Oluwaseun Aiyedatiwa, described the choice of Ondo State as host as a testament to the First Lady’s motherly love. She praised the RHI programme for its focus on healthcare and women’s empowerment, while also thanking the women of Ondo State for turning out in large numbers to honour the First Lady.

The Minister of State for Health, Dr. Iziaq Adekunle Salako, in his remarks, said the programme is a key tool in the fight against maternal mortality. “This is how we build a resilient healthcare system—by recognizing and supporting those at the frontlines,” he noted.

Echoing similar sentiments, the Executive Secretary of the National Primary Health Care Development Agency (NPHCDA), Dr. Muyi Aina, commended both the President and the First Lady for their commitment to healthcare. “This initiative is strengthening the foundations of our healthcare system and ensuring no one is left behind,” he said.

As part of her visit, Mrs. Tinubu also paid a courtesy call on the National Leader of Afenifere, Pa Reuben Famuyide Fasoranti, at his residence, receiving his blessings and commendation.
